Soil Contamination

Digital squander (e-squander) has emerged as a big contributor to soil contamination, predominantly because of the existence of significant metals and toxic chemicals in Digital gadgets. Through the entire lifetime cycle of Digital functions including generation, disposal, and recycling, large metal pollution can take place, leading to soil contamination.

E-squander recycling web sites, especially These located in Bangalore, New Delhi, together with other places, have already been recognized as hotspots for soil contamination. Scientific studies have revealed elevated levels of weighty metals, including guide, cadmium, mercury, and arsenic, inside the soil bordering these web-sites. Additionally, the soil in close proximity to e-squander recycling services in these spots has become found to include superior amounts of PBDEs (polybrominated diphenyl ethers), PCBs (polychlorinated biphenyls), PCDD/Fs (polychlorinated dibenzo-p-dioxins and dibenzofurans), and PAHs (polycyclic aromatic hydrocarbons).

The existence of such contaminants within the soil poses substantial ecological and wellbeing hazards. Weighty metals can accumulate in crops, animals, and also the foodstuff chain, finally impacting biodiversity and ecosystems. Furthermore, exposure to those harmful substances from contaminated soil might have harmful outcomes on human well being, which include neurological disorders, reproductive concerns, and amplified most cancers threats.

In summary, e-waste things to do, specifically incorrect recycling approaches, lead to soil contamination through large steel air pollution and also the presence of harmful chemical substances. The elevated amounts of weighty metals, PBDEs, PCBs, PCDD/Fs, and PAHs found in soil from e-squander recycling websites in Bangalore, New Delhi, along with other areas pose prospective ecological and overall health threats. Proper administration and regulated recycling procedures are vital in mitigating soil contamination a result of e-squander.

Human Wellbeing Impacts

E-waste air pollution has important health impacts on people as a result of exposure to harmful substances such as guide, mercury, and polycyclic aromatic hydrocarbons (PAHs). These substances are generally present in electronic products and can be unveiled into your environment as a result of inappropriate disposal and informal e-squander recycling techniques.

Exposure to guide, a weighty metallic normally Utilized in electronics, might have extreme outcomes for human health and fitness. It could possibly harm the anxious system, resulting in neurological Problems and cognitive impairments. Mercury, A different toxic metal found in e-waste, can have an impact on various organ systems and is particularly hazardous for the developing brain of unborn young children and youthful kids.

PAHs, which happen to be produced in the incomplete burning of organic and natural materials like plastics, are also current in e-waste. These substances are acknowledged being carcinogenic and happen to be linked to an increased danger of assorted cancers, which include lung and bladder cancer.

Expecting Ladies and unborn little ones are Particularly prone to the adverse consequences of e-waste air pollution. Publicity to toxic substances throughout pregnancy may end up in adverse beginning outcomes, including preterm birth, very low start body weight, and developmental troubles. Also, experiments have prompt that publicity to e-waste pollutants in utero can result in an elevated hazard of chronic disorders later on in life, such as cardiovascular illnesses and metabolic Problems.

Harmful Resources in E-Waste

E-waste, or electronic waste, incorporates hazardous materials that can have intense environmental and health impacts Otherwise correctly managed. Some typical harmful resources found in e-waste include things like mercury, direct, cadmium, polybrominated flame retardants, and barium.

Inappropriate e-squander management practices, for example burning or dumping, can release these hazardous substances into the ecosystem. When e-squander is incinerated, one example is, poisonous products like mercury and flame retardants are produced in the air, contributing to air pollution and posing a hazard to human wellbeing. When e-squander will not be effectively disposed of in landfills, major metals like guide, cadmium, and barium can leach to the soil and contaminate groundwater, posing a menace to ecosystems and likely getting into the food items chain.

These dangerous materials existing a variety of unfavorable impacts. Mercury exposure can cause damage to the nervous technique, while lead exposure is connected to developmental troubles in young children and cognitive impairments in Grown ups. Cadmium exposure can cause kidney hurt, and flame retardants are associated with hormone disruption and potential carcinogenic outcomes. Barium, when ingested, can have an impact on the cardiovascular method and lead to increased blood pressure.
